What shapes your price? The type and size of bus you choose, how many hours you need it, the day of the week, and where your trip starts and ends all factor in. A 15-passenger minibus for a short airport transfer costs differently than a 56-passenger motorcoach for a full Masters Week shuttle package.
Weekend and peak-event pricing — especially during Masters Week in April — runs higher than weekday rates, so earlier is always better.

Augusta Regional Airport (AGS) (1501 Aviation Way, Augusta, GA 30906) is the region's primary commercial airport, served by American Eagle and Delta, and sits approximately 6 miles south of downtown Augusta. Charter bus and shuttle pickup is curbside on the lower level outside baggage claim — gather your entire group and all luggage before calling the bus forward, since commercial vehicles stage nearby and pull to the curb once everyone is ready to board.
Need to reach Hartsfield-Jackson Atlanta International Airport (ATL), approximately 2.5 hours west on I-20? Or Savannah/Hilton Head International Airport (SAV), about two hours south? A full-size motorcoach with reclining seats, WiFi, and undercarriage luggage bays makes either run comfortable for the whole group.

Phinizy Swamp Nature Park (1858 Lock and Dam Rd, Augusta, GA 30906) is one of the most popular field trip destinations in the area — a 1,100-acre urban wetland and nature preserve perfect for environmental education, with bus access via Lock and Dam Road. The Augusta Canal Discovery Center at Enterprise Mill (1450 Greene St, Augusta, GA 30901) offers canal boat tours and exhibits on one of the only intact pre-Civil War industrial canals in the country, with bus drop-off at Enterprise Mill on Greene Street.
The Augusta Museum of History (560 Reynolds St, Augusta, GA 30901) covers Augusta's full history including a significant James Brown exhibit, with bus drop-off along Reynolds Street.

The single biggest transportation event in the Augusta calendar is The Masters Tournament at Augusta National Golf Club (2604 Washington Rd, Augusta, GA 30904), held April 9–12, 2026, with practice rounds beginning April 6. Washington Road and the surrounding corridors experience extreme gridlock during Masters Week — a charter bus navigates the approach while your group avoids hunting for one of the extremely limited parking spots in the area.
Masters Week transportation books out six months to a year in advance, so the earlier you call, the better your options.
For Augusta GreenJackets games at SRP Park (187 Railroad Ave, North Augusta, SC 29841), bus drop-off runs along Railroad Avenue just across the Savannah River. The IRONMAN 70.3 Augusta triathlon in September draws large numbers of athletes and spectators and creates significant transportation demand across the metro. Augusta National Golf Club coordinates patron transportation on an event-by-event basis during The Masters, and the club does not publish a standing public charter bus drop-off map. During Masters Week — April 9–12, 2026, with practice rounds beginning April 6 — Washington Road and surrounding corridors experience extreme gridlock, and parking is extremely limited for private vehicles. Remote patron shuttle lots, including the former Bush Field terminal area, serve as staging points for official shuttle operations.
For a private charter, your bus will approach via Washington Road and coordinate drop-off based on the access arrangements in place for your specific event date. Confirm current access details with Augusta National's patron services team as Masters Week approaches, and book your charter bus as early as possible — Masters Week transportation fills six months to a year in advance.

SRP Park is located just across the Savannah River in North Augusta, South Carolina — about three miles from downtown Augusta. Bus drop-off runs along Railroad Avenue adjacent to the ballpark, with parking available in the lots surrounding the Hammond's Ferry development. The GreenJackets play their home season from April through September, and the park also hosts concerts and community events throughout the year.
Confirm current event-day access details with SRP Park guest services before your visit, since traffic management can vary by event size.

For most Augusta trips, booking three to four months in advance gives you the best combination of vehicle selection and pricing. For Masters Week — the single highest-demand period in Augusta's calendar — book six months to a year in advance, because charter bus availability genuinely fills that early. Prom season across Richmond County high schools runs April through May and also books out fast; aim for three to six months out for prom dates.
For other peak periods like IRONMAN 70.3 Augusta in September and Augusta University commencement in May, two to three months is a safe window. The earlier you book, the more options you will have — and the more likely you are to get the specific vehicle and price point you want.
